About this listen

The New Testament church was founded upon the teachings of the Lord Jesus Christ and His apostles. The New Testament was finally completed and the last apostle died just before the end of the first century. It is in their writings that God has delivered to the human race the surest, most reliable and accurate words regarding salvation. Yet, somehow through time, the original demands of Jesus and His apostles have been degraded and dismissed as meaningless mandates, senseless stipulations and irrelevant rhetoric. This book is a full-frontal assault on the partial truths, blatant lies and trite traditions that have not only besieged modern Christianity but have actually infiltrated it. This book is a decree to discard the "cunningly devised fables of men". And it is a commission to reencounter the soul-purifying truths of the faith that was delivered first. Christianity
